    Industrial and Workforce Development

    in Bliss

     
     

    14 | HelloBliss, Idaho • Fall Issue

    Rectangle
    Nestled along the Snake River in south-central Idaho, Bliss is strategically positioned for industrial and logistics operations seeking access to both regional and interstate markets. The city benefits from its proximity to Interstate 84, a major transportation corridor connecting Boise, Salt Lake City, and the Pacific Northwest, making it an attractive site for distribution and light manufacturing. Industrial activity in Bliss and the surrounding Gooding County region has seen renewed interest, particularly from agribusiness and food processing sectors. The area offers affordable land, low property taxes, and a business-friendly regulatory environment, which together lower the total cost of development for new industrial projects. Idaho’s statewide incentives, including the Tax Reimbursement Incentive and the Workforce Development Training Fund, are accessible to qualifying companies looking to expand or relocate in Bliss. Local support is available through the Southern Idaho Economic Development organization, which assists with site selection, permitting, and workforce connections. Workforce development is further supported by partnerships with the College of Southern Idaho and local high schools, providing training programs tailored to manufacturing, logistics, and value-added agriculture. These efforts help ensure a steady pipeline of skilled labor for growing employers in the region.

    Quality of Life & Other Advantages

    • Bliss offers a low cost of living, scenic landscapes, and a relaxed pace of life, making it attractive for both businesses and their employees.
    • Access to outdoor recreation—including fishing, hiking, and river sports—enhances employee satisfaction and work-life balance.
    • Reliable transportation infrastructure (Interstate 84, nearby rail) and robust utility services support industrial operations and future growth.
